Side-by-Side Comparison

Feature zähe Zange
Definition Nominativ Singular Femininum der starken Deklination des Positivs des Adjektivs zäh ein Werkzeug aus zwei ineinandergreifenden Backen, welche nach unten hin für die händische Bedienung als Schenkel verlängert sind

Spelling & Dictionary Insight

These two trip readers on the page rather than in the ear: zähe is [ˈt͡sɛːə] while Zange is [ˈt͡saŋə]. Spoken aloud the problem disappears. In writing it persists, because they differ by 1 letter(s) in length, and the parts of speech differ too (adjective vs noun), which is usually the fastest check.
